Managing Water Quality on Rural Land
Rural land sits at the head of most freshwater catchments. How land is managed — whether for farming, forestry, or lifestyle use — has a direct influence on stream health, water quality, and the condition of downstream rivers, estuaries, and coastal environments.
Managing water quality at the catchment scale helps:
- protect freshwater ecosystems
- support safe swimming and recreation
- provide reliable stock drinking water
- reduce pressure on estuaries and coastal areas
- strengthen resilience to heavy rainfall and drought
Water quality improves most effectively when actions are coordinated across whole catchments, with landowners and communities working together upstream and downstream.
How Land Use Effects Waterways
A catchment is the area of land where rainfall drains into a stream, river, wetland, or estuary. Water doesn’t stop at fence lines — it carries sediment, nutrients, and bacteria from across the landscape.
On rural land, waterways can be affected by:
- stock access to streams
- runoff during rainfall events
- erosion from slopes, tracks, and gullies
- loss of riparian vegetation
- earthworks or forestry operations
Managing these pressures upstream plays a key role in improving water quality downstream.
Understanding E. Coli & Water Quality
E. coli bacteria are found in the gut of animals, including humans. They can enter waterways directly when animals stand or swim in streams, or indirectly when faecal material is washed off land during rainfall.
While not all strains are harmful, E. coli is widely used as an indicator of water contamination. Elevated levels can signal the presence of other pathogens and can make waterways unsafe for contact recreation and stock drinking water.
An effective way to reduce E. coli entering streams is to fence and plant stream margins. Fencing prevents livestock from depositing faeces directly into waterways and reduces stream‑bank erosion. Maintaining long grass and planting riparian margins within fenced areas helps stabilise banks, slow surface runoff, filter contaminants, and reduce bacteria entering the stream.
Reducing E. coli levels relies on good land management across the whole catchment.

Good Practices That Protect Water Quality
Actions that help protect streams and rivers include:
- fencing stock away from waterways
- maintaining riparian vegetation along stream margins
- managing runoff pathways and drainage
- stabilising erosion‑prone areas
- careful siting of yards, crossings, and tracks
- maintaining ground cover during wetter months
These practices support water quality while also improving long‑term land resilience.
